#0d1f2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d1f2c is composed of 5.1% red, 12.2%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 29.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 205.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 11.2%. #0d1f2c color hex could be obtained by blending #1a3e58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#0d1f2c color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.
#0d1f2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d1f2c has RGB values of R:13, G:31,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 859948.

Shades and Tints of #0d1f2c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a0e is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d1f2c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1c1d1d is the less saturated color, while #022137 is the most saturated one.
